India has undermined a popular myth about development

Thirty years in the past Siddharth Dube, a author, visited a small village in northern India close to the location of a historic peasants’ revolt. He discovered loads that remained enraging: mud huts, primitive ploughs, “barefoot outdated males” and “bone-thin kids”. One older villager, Ram Dass, recalled the bitter deprivation of his youthful years, when he would work lengthy days on another person’s land for the meagre reward of 1.5kg of grain. On chilly nights, the poor stuffed rice stalks into outdated garments to maintain heat. “What did we all know what a quilt was?” A person was fortunate to personal a single pair of footwear from his wedding ceremony to his dying.
